Great questions on the podcast this week from Mark, Lynne and Carrie. Mark has questions about how to properly finance the decision to downsize to a smaller house. Lynne is wondering about working with big financial companies vs. independent advisors. And Carrie says an advisor is forcing her and her husband to live on a budget. It's a requirement for them to work together. She wants to know if that's normal and if Matt has seen other examples like this where advisors place certain "rules" on the client/advisor relationship.
